DAIRY PRODUCTS LINKED TO PROSTATE CANCER RISK


If you love cheese and milk, beware. Dairy products could up your prostate cancer risk, according to a new report.

Researchers from the Mayo Clinic recently conducted a study, published in the Journal of the American Osteopathic Association, to explore whether plant and animal-based foods increase prostate cancer risk. To do so, they examined over 47 existing studies on the topic that involved more than 1 million participants. They gathered information about the subjects' diets and lifestyle habits, such as whether they smoked or exercised.

After analyzing the results, the team found a high consumption of dairy products, like milk and cheese, was associated with a higher chance of developing prostate cancer. There was no apparent link between increased prostate cancer risk and other animal-based foods, such as white meat, fish and eggs,where as plant-based diet was found to decrease the risk of prostate cancer.
